Easy Tips For Applying Sunlabs Self Tanner On The Skin Properly

By Haywood Hunter


If you are eager to use a Sunlabs self tanner to get deep, dark skin, you should learn a few things before starting. There are numerous product options that people can choose from. Different formulas will produce a darker hue than others. For this reason, you will need to first choose a solution that is formulated to produce the amount of change you actually want.



One of the most important things to do before applying a Sunlabs self tanner is to properly clean the skin. You should always take a shower or bath before attempting to apply a topical lotion of this type. This is also true if you will be losing a spray.

It is also necessary to shave off any unwanted hair in the areas that you are going to coat with Sunlabs self tanner before the application process is started. The final results can be affected considerably by excess hair. Sometimes this causes the skin to look spotty and uneven. After you have shaved and finished your bath or show, you should dry the dermis carefully before the Sunlabs self tanner is put on. Wet skin can sometimes cause streaks to develop.



It is never a good idea to wax the skin directly before putting a Sunlabs self tanner on. Waxing is much more harsh on the skin's surface. You should let your dermis rest at least one full day before starting to apply any tanning solution. Otherwise, waxing is as good a hair removal technique as any other.

It is also necessary to exfoliate away dead, dry skin if you want to get the best possible benefits from your Sunlabs self tanner. Dry skin can have a very damaging effect on the end result and this may start to peel off after the treatment is finished. You can do this with your body bouf, a washcloth or a special body brush.

Once all of these things have been completed, you are just about ready to put your Sunlabs self tanner on. You must make certain that you have allotted sufficient time for the entire process. You will need a private area and at least sixty minutes for the application to be complete. This is because you will not be able to get dressed until all of the Sunlabs self tanner solution has set. If you do, this will potentially rub the wet product off, thereby ruining your results.

Having sufficient time for the Sunlabs self tanner to dry is important but you will additionally need to make sure that standing throughout this time will be possible as well. If you sit down or lie on top of something, a lot of the solution will rub off. This can cause staining and will make you look splotchy.

You must remember that you cannot get dressed at all until the Sunlabs self tanner is finished drying. You can, however, walk and move around a bit at this time, as this will facilitate quicker drying. If you are careful to adhere to these directives, you can get an evenly bronzed look without harmful exposure to the rays of the sun.
